Understanding the Challenge

India is at a pivotal moment regarding artificial intelligence (AI) leadership. The country faces a significant shortage of skilled leaders who can effectively harness AI’s potential. This gap hinders the ability of industries to innovate and grow, despite the promising economic contributions AI could bring. A recent survey revealed that nearly half of senior executives lack foundational AI knowledge, highlighting the urgent need for enhanced training and educational programs.

Key Insights

  • AI adoption in India surged by over 45% in three years, transforming sectors like healthcare and finance.
  • Companies that invest in AI can see revenue increases of up to 38%, but without strong leadership, these gains may not be realized.
  • Educational institutions need to update their curricula to provide practical AI skills, moving beyond theoretical knowledge.
  • Government initiatives, such as creating AI Centres of Excellence, are essential for fostering a robust AI ecosystem.

The Bigger Picture

Developing strong AI leadership is crucial for India’s economic future. Without skilled leaders, businesses risk falling behind in innovation and losing their competitive edge. This gap also threatens India’s position as a global technology leader and its ability to attract international investments. By addressing this leadership shortage through education, upskilling, and supportive government policies, India can unlock AI’s full potential, driving economic growth and enhancing its standing in the global market.
